Time-weighted average values are calculated as the sum of exposure during a workday to a particular hazardous substance in ppm-hours and dividing it by an 8-hour period: TWA= (t1c1+t2c2++tncn) / number of hours in the workday. The OEL for Asbestos There are two OELs for asbestos; the first is the eight hour time weighted average (TWA) TLV and the OSHA PEL of 0.1 fibers per cubic centimeter of air (f/cc) (reference 3 and 4). Because there are many types of materials with different degrees of hazards, OSHAs air contaminants standard (29 CFR 1910.1000) includes the three PEL tables, Table Z-1 (limits for air contaminants), Table Z-2 (limits for substances with ceiling values), and Table Z-3 (mineral dusts). According to 1910.1000(b)(2), an employees exposure to a substance listed in Table Z-2 shall not exceed at any time during an 8-hour shift the acceptable ceiling concentration limit given for the substance in the table, except for a time period, and up to a concentration not exceeding the maximum duration and concentration allowed in the column under acceptable maximum peak above the acceptable ceiling concentration for an 8-hour shift..
